Abstract

This project presents the application of Ant Colony Optimization (ACO) technique for the determination of optimal sizing of Static Var Compensator (SVC) installed on a transmission line for loss minimization and voltage profile stability in power system IEEE reliability test system was used for validation purposes. SVC is the one of the Flexible AC Transmission System (FACTS) devices. In recent practice, the use of FACTS devices has been proposed for enhancement of power grid protection and control in power system by improving the stability, reduction of losses and generation cost and improves the loadability of the system. However, prohibitive cost is major stumbling block for utility company to install more than a few FACTS devices on any power grid. Therefore, with this project, the optimal sizing of SVC for solving the loss and voltage stability problems will be determined.
